Synopsis: |
The catalog features the paper and plaster counterparts of the artist's well-known bronze sculptures. The paper versions seem light and fragile-visually as well as literally. The "Interconnected Sculptures", revolving around one another in asymmetrical circles, are handpainted several times so they can support their own weight. The white finish renders them timeless. These pieces of art can be seen as metaphors for the circle of life, uniting time and space in their characteristic formal appearances. Today one of the most important representatives of contemporary sculpture, the German artist Christian has gained an excellent reputation since he was 19 years old, when giving his debut at the documenta 5. He lives in New York, Hayama (Japan) and D??sseldorf, (Germany). |
